AI engineer (Python)

At airSlate, our journey began in Boston, USA, in 2008. What started as a single product with 3,000 customers has grown into an influential tech company with 900+  team members across six offices worldwide. In 2022, airSlate reached a total valuation of $1.25 billion and became a  'Unicorn 🦄'. But even as we scale, team members remain our most valuable asset. That's why we've built a company that excites people about their work.


We develop products that serve over 100 million users with no-code workflow automation, electronic signature, and document management solutions. The company's portfolio of award-winning products, signNow, pdfFiller, DocHub, WorkFlow, Instapage, and US Legal Forms, empower teams to digitally transform the way their organizations run.


About GenAI team:


The team is focused on developing agentic AI implementations for both product-facing features and the core of our marketing engine platform. Our work spans the entire spectrum of Large Language Model (LLM) activities, including prompt engineering, ret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), and fine-tuning—all tailored to enhance our core marketing engine and product features.


We leverage extensive natural language datasets and have access to cutting-edge LLM technologies, enabling us to push the boundaries of AI-driven marketing solutions. Team members collaborate closely with our core machine learning research group, working on advanced enterprise applications of LLMs.


This role offers the opportunity to engage in both foundational AI research and its practical deployment, ensuring innovative and impactful solutions in the marketing and automotive sectors.

What you'll be working on:
  • Develop and maintain AI-driven applications leveraging LLMs, R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ation), and AI agent frameworks;
  • Design, implement, and optimize APIs and microservices, ensuring scalability and performance;
  • Work with various database systems, including relational, NoSQL, and vector databases;
  • Integrate and optimize message queue brokers for distributed system architectures;
  • Collaborate on prompt engineering, evaluation strategies, and fine-tuning LLM-based applications;
  • Build and maintain cloud-native applications using AWS and containerization tools;
  • Design and build new services from scratch for AI agents ecosystem;
  • Improve engineering standards, tooling, and processes;
  • Actively participate in code reviews;
  • Increase system’s performance and scalability;
  • Implement integrations with other products APIs.


What we expect from you:
  • Strong proficiency in Python and experience with modern frameworks (FastAPI, Flask, Django);
  • Experience with tools and best practices in the Python ecosystem (Poetry, virtual environments, dependency management);
  • Experience with LLM-based solutions, including prompt engineering, retrieval strategies, and evaluation;
  • Solid understanding of data design and database management (SQL, NoSQL, VectorDB);
  • Experience designing scalable RESTful APIs and working with asynchronous programming (asyncio, FastAPI, Celery);
  • Hands-on experience with R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) and search pipelines;
  • Knowledge of message queue brokers (RabbitMQ, Kafka, Redis Streams);
  • Experience with Git, GitHub, and CI/CD tools for automated testing and deployment;
  • Proficiency in c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, Azure) and containerization (Docker, Kubernetes);
  • High level of self-awareness, problem-solving, and proactivity.


What helps you rock:
  • Familiarity with LangChain, LangGraph, or other AI agent orchestration frameworks;
  • Hands-on experience with search and retrieval systems (Elasticsearch, Weaviate, FAISS, Vespa);
  • Understanding of ML Ops practices (model deployment, monitoring, scaling);
  • Experience optimizing LLM inference performance (quantization, distillation, caching);
  • Exposure to NLP frameworks (Hugging Face, spaCy, NLTK, OpenAI APIs);
  • Knowledge of workflow orchestration tools (Kubeflow, Airflow, Prefect) for AI pipelines;
  • Experience with data pipelines and feature stores (Kafka, DVC, Feast);
  • Understanding of security & compliance requirements for AI applications (data privacy, access control);
  • Familiarity with knowledge graphs and reasoning engines (Neo4j, RDF, SPARQL).
